DATA DEMODULATION METHOD FOR DECREASING EFFECT OF IMPULSIVE NOISE BASED ON MULTI-CARRIER AND APPARATUS THEREOF

机译:基于多载波及其装置的降低脉冲噪声影响的数据解调方法

摘要

PURPOSE: A data demodulation method for decreasing effect of impulsive noise based on multi-carrier and apparatus therefore is provided to modulate data transmitted through a data symbol by performing frequency conversion of restored receiving signal. CONSTITUTION: In a data demodulation method for decreasing effect of impulsive noise based on multi-carrier and apparatus therefore, a signal corresponding to a data symbol is received(S610). The received signal is divided into a plurality of groups by using the constant period of a time region index(S620). The signal quality value of a plurality of groups is calculated(S630). A normal group having no impulse noise and an abnormal group having impulse noise are determined by using signal quality value(S640). The abnormal group is restored by using the normal group(S650). Transmitted data is modulated through the data symbol using receiving signal which is converted into a frequency area and the data transmission pattern of the data symbol(S660,S670).
